The multi-station cold-forged American straight knurled hexagonal hand screw is a precision mechanical fastener that combines high strength, convenient installation and anti-slip properties. Its core functions can be systematically summarized as follows.

 

1. High-strength fastening function
Multi-station cold-forging forming: Through multiple cold-forging processes, the metal fibers are continuous and dense, and the tensile strength and shear resistance are significantly higher than ordinary cutting screws, which are suitable for high-load scenarios.

American-made hexagonal drive: The hexagonal hole provides high torque transmission capacity, avoids the risk of slipping teeth of cross or slotted notches, and is suitable for frequent disassembly and assembly.

2. Convenience of hand-tightening operation
Straight knurling design: The cylindrical head surface is pressed with straight knurling to increase the friction coefficient. It can be tightened or disassembled by hand, even with gloves or in an oily environment. No special tools are required. It is suitable for small spaces or quick maintenance scenarios.

Round head shape optimization: The round head design avoids sharp edges, protects the operator's hand safety, and reduces the risk of scratching the installation surface.

3. Precise positioning and anti-loosening performance
Machine thread: Precision turning thread matches standard nut or threaded hole to ensure a tight bite and prevent loosening.

Hexagon socket + knurling dual drive redundancy: It can be fastened with a hexagonal wrench at high torque, and can be manually fine-tuned through knurling to meet the needs of different installation stages.

4. Environmental adaptability
Material and surface treatment: Optional carbon steel grade 8.8 or grade 12.9, stainless steel and other materials, galvanized, blackened or Dacromet-treated on the surface, corrosion resistance meets the diverse indoor and outdoor environments.

Temperature tolerance: The cold heading process retains the original performance of the material, and the operating temperature range is from -50℃ to 300℃, depending on the material.

 

5. Standardization compatibility
American standard: The thread specifications and head dimensions meet the American standard, are compatible with general equipment in the North American market, and support metric conversion.

Typical application scenarios
Industrial equipment: Quick disassembly and assembly of instrument panels and motor housings.

Electronic appliances: Server cabinets and radiator fixings.

Car modification: Hand-tightening of interior parts and wiring harness clips.

Furniture hardware: Tool-free installation of hidden adjustment parts in high-end furniture.

Design advantage summary
This fastener achieves a balance of strength, convenience, and reliability through the cold heading process to strengthen the structure, knurling + hexagonal dual drive design, and standardized compatibility. It is a high-performance solution between traditional tool fastening and pure hand-tightening parts.
